Comprehending Different Kinds Of Lawn Sprinkler Solutions
While assessing various automatic sprinkler, property owners will find several options tailored to various landscaping needs. The most usual kinds include drip watering, spray sprinklers, and rotating lawn sprinklers. Leak irrigation delivers water straight to the plant roots, making it highly reliable for gardens and blossom beds. Spray lawn sprinklers, which distribute water in a fan-shaped pattern, are excellent for tiny to tool grass and can cover certain areas successfully. Assessing Water Stress and Supply
Exactly how can house owners guarantee their lawn sprinkler system runs successfully? Evaluating water stress and supply is necessary in this process. Home owners should first measure their water stress, generally ranging from 30 to 80 psi. A pressure gauge can be connected to an exterior tap for exact readings. Low tide stress might demand the installation of a booster pump, while excessively high stress can harm the automatic sprinkler and need pressure regulation.Additionally, reviewing the supply of water is vital. House owners should think about the quantity of water offered, particularly during optimal use hours. This can be figured out by computing the result of numerous faucets or hoses running at the same time. Guaranteeing that the supply of water satisfies the system's demands will stop completely dry areas and uneven watering in the landscape. Seasonal Adjustments Needed
As the periods change, adjusting the lawn sprinkler becomes necessary for preserving its performance and guaranteeing excellent plant health and wellness. In spring, house owners should boost watering period to suit brand-new growth, while keeping an eye on rains to protect against overwatering. Summertime often needs one of the most significant modifications; timers might require to be readied to run during cooler hours to lessen evaporation. As fall strategies, decreasing watering regularity allows plants to get ready for dormancy. In wintertime, several systems ought to be winterized to stop damage from freezing temperatures. Exactly how Commonly Should I Run My Automatic Sprinkler?
The frequency of running a lawn sprinkler system relies on climate, soil kind, and plant needs. Generally, sprinkling 2 to 3 times a week is recommended, adjusting based on rainfall and seasonal modifications for optimal outcomes.
What Is the Typical Lifespan of an Automatic Sprinkler?
The typical life-span of a lawn sprinkler system commonly varies from 10 to twenty years, depending upon maintenance, use, and environmental factors. Routine care can considerably enhance its longevity and total performance in sprinkling landscapes.

How Do I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ler?
To winterize a lawn sprinkler, one must first turn off the water supply, then drain pipes the system completely. Additionally, utilizing pressed air to blow out staying water from the lines stops freezing and potential damages.
